FORM
Just when you start
to get things in hand
under control, you know,
tied or battened down
like you might a hatch
on a seafaring vessel
if you didn't feel obligated
to enter it and see
what's underneath
the hood, your feet, the electrics
of your heart—
just when you have collected
the remainders of the mirror
and the lamp
and whatever you found inside the wreck
when you dove down toward it
(everything was broken
(everything is broken
but you bring it back up anyway)
but you brought it back up anyway
in later conversations
about the subject)—
just when you think you have it all together,
surprise, you do!
—you can hold it for a moment
as it poses
poised against the precipice |
